Although EX is advertised as a gigging unit, it falls far short in many essential areas. The EX was what the ST was meant to have been although those somewhat tinny, pointless speakers in the EX was the idea of Korg, not Vox. The 2-button ST wasn't meant to be so basic - it was rushed out as a stop gap because Vox unwisely withdrew the LE with no replacement, and were losing ground as they were out of the mfx market for too long. DT, LE and SE mix in DSP with analogue gain stages - ST and EX are more DSP focussed, again to reduce circuit design and cost.ST and EX have way less processing power, again to save on cost.The valvereactor circuit has been simplified and 'dumbed down' to save cost.To my ears they lack the fuller, bigger, punchier and more valvelike warmth that made the originals such a hit with guitarists. Tonally although they do sound quite good to be fair with a brighter EQ floor, IMO they are more digital sounding and 'processed'. Although they have the merits of being much smaller and lighter than the SE and LE, they are made to a budget and are aimed more at the amateur/home player market.

Some of the newer effects are quite nice sounding and the EX offers 2 pedal sections for greater flexibility including a nice exciter effect.īut in terms of professional utility and pure gigability they are toys by comparison to LE and SE. On paper ST & EX have more up to date modelling and offer 33 amp models instead of 16, but too many of those 33 amp models sound so similar that they are simply not worth having. For example, there are far fewer delay & reverb options, and even to those you don't have access to the refined parameters for delay and reverb found in DT, LE & SE which means you can't accurately set delay and reverb timings etc.
